Planning notes for Pakistani Muslim weddings
Before the wedding, share each event date, venue or city, ceremony details, portrait needs, and any privacy preferences. For Pakistani Muslim weddings, it helps to know how the Nikah will be arranged, whether the Baraat and Walima are separate events, and when family portraits should happen. If your wedding includes Mehendi, Mayoon, Rukhsati, or other family events, include those details so the coverage plan reflects the full celebration.
It is also useful to share whether events are gender-separate, whether any part of the ceremony should be photographed discreetly, and which family members should be prioritized for portraits. Those details keep the plan respectful and practical.
A clear plan also helps balance formal portraits, candid family moments, entrances, speeches, and the emotional Rukhsati without crowding the schedule.
